Sacramento to San Francisco

86 miData through May 2026Source: US DOT · BTS

Flights on SMF–SFO arrive on time 65% of the time over the last 12 months.

On-time rate65%arrived within 15 min
p90 delay60 min1 in 10 flights is worse (tail risk)
Cancelled1.7%of scheduled flights

based on 1,376 flights over the last 12 months. On-time means arriving within 15 minutes (BTS standard).

Why flights run late

Delay causes

  • Airline28%
  • Weather8%
  • Air traffic (NAS)38%
  • Late aircraft27%
  • Security0%

Most delay minutes here are attributed to Air traffic (NAS).

When to fly

Best time to fly SMF → SFO

All airlines · rolling 36 months (2023-06 .. 2026-05).

Best time of day

Mornings are the most reliable time of day to fly this route — 91% on time.

  • Mornings91% on time · p90 10 min · 977 flights
  • Afternoons76% on time · p90 50 min · 811 flights
  • Evenings71% on time · p90 55 min · 312 flights
  • Middays70% on time · p90 50 min · 1,004 flights
  • Overnights53% on time · p90 55 min · 426 flights

Best day of week

On-time rates are fairly even by day on this route — ranging from 70% to 81% on time.

  • Saturdays81% on time · p90 30 min · 482 flights
  • Tuesdays79% on time · p90 30 min · 504 flights
  • Thursdays75% on time · p90 50 min · 515 flights
  • Sundays75% on time · p90 45 min · 487 flights
  • Wednesdays74% on time · p90 50 min · 513 flights
  • Fridays72% on time · p90 45 min · 516 flights
  • Mondays70% on time · p90 50 min · 513 flights

Methodology

A flight is on time when it arrives within 15 minutes of schedule — the US DOT / BTS standard. Median and p90(the “1-in-10 bad day”) are read from the full arrival-delay distribution, never averaged across periods.

Figures cover a carrier’s own BTS-coded flights. Cells below ~200 flights are flagged as limited data. All numbers are pre-computed from public BTS On-Time Performance data.
